Church Parking Lot Striping in Alpharetta, GA

Church parking lot striping services involve the application of durable, clearly visible lines and markings to organize vehicle flow and maximize space efficiency. This project typically covers large-scale surfaces such as parking lots, aisles, designated parking spaces, handicap zones, and directional arrows. Property owners often seek this service to improve safety, ensure compliance with accessibility standards, and create a professional appearance for their property. Before requesting striping,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the lot, the desired layout, and any specific markings or signage that need to be included.

Proper planning is essential to achieve an effective parking lot layout that meets local regulations and accommodates the needs of visitors. Property owners should consider the size of the lot, the number of parking spaces required, and any special zones such as fire lanes or reserved spots. It’s also important to discuss surface conditions, as existing markings may need removal or repainting, and to clarify the type of paint or marking material preferred for durability.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the finished project aligns with the property’s operational requirements.

Church Parking Lot Striping Questions

What is the purpose of parking lot striping for churches? It helps organize parking spaces, improves safety, and ensures clear traffic flow within the lot.

How often should parking lot lines be repainted? Repainting is typically needed every one to three years, depending on traffic and weather conditions.

What types of markings are common in church parking lots? Common markings include designated parking spaces, fire lanes, accessible spots, and directional arrows.

Can parking lot striping be customized for church needs? Yes, markings can be tailored to include specific symbols, reserved spaces, or custom layouts as required.
